The Motus GI Colon Cleansing device is intended to facilitate intra-procedural cleaning of a poorly prepared colon by irrigating the colon and evacuating the irrigation fluid and feces.

The study aim to evaluate the post Procedure Cleansing Level as Measured by the Boston Bowel Preparation Scale (BBPS).
Each subject was required to follow a bowel preparation regimen including split dose of 2 tablets of 5mg Bysacodyle followed by a colonoscopy procedure with the tested device.
